IE9以下版本兼容h5標簽
隨著html5(後面用h5代表)標簽越來越廣泛的使用,IE9以下(IE6-IE8)不識別h5標簽的問題讓人很是煩惱。
在火狐和chrome之類的瀏覽器中,遇到不認識的標簽,只要給個display:block屬性,就能讓這個元素成為一個類似div的元素,但是到IE上就很惡心了,它不認識就是不認識,你在html和css裏添加什麽它都不理你。
沒什麽什麽問題是萬能的程序猿解決不了的,其實要讓IE識別一個自定義的標簽(IE認為h5的標簽是陌生的,不合法的)
html5--html5shiv.js插件下載
https://github.com/aFarkas/html5shiv/releases
css3--selectivizr-min.js插件下載
http://selectivizr.com/
以上兩個插件常在項目中運用較多。在html頁面中的<head>標簽裏面插入下載好的js文件,頁面就可以正常添加html5元素了,css3樣式
IE9以下版本兼容h5標簽
相關推薦
IE9以下版本兼容h5標簽
運用 itl rom str 瀏覽器中 好的 項目 afa 陌生 隨著html5(後面用h5代表)標簽越來越廣泛的使用,IE9以下(IE6-IE8)不識別h5標簽的問題讓人很是煩惱。 在火狐和chrome之類的瀏覽器中,遇到不認識的標簽,只要給個display:block屬
【hack】ie8如何兼容html5標簽
datalist var ack lock spa 解決 asi while 識別不了 ie8是識別不了html5語義化標簽的,解決方法: 在頭部文件的<head></head>裏面下如下代碼 (這段代碼的意思是如果ie版本低於ie8,就創建所
input事件在ie9以下不兼容問題完美解決
change != 失效 蛋疼 事件 失去焦點 htm ie瀏覽器 定義 上周四好不容易加了幾天班把剛接手的一個pc頁面做完,周五同事說要兼容ie7~ie9,結果在上面一跑,輸入都沒法輸入。 我的需求是用6個span作為虛擬的密碼輸入框,實際上是用一個藏在頁面裏的inpu
使用document.getElementsByClassName 老版本IE9以前的版本兼容
clas res ++ ie9 class 找到 str 問題 定義 /** * 根據類名查找元素,解決瀏覽器兼容問題 * @param className <String> 待查找的類名 * @return 返回查找到的元素集合 */function byCl
針對IE低版本兼容性問題的一些解決方案
style 兼容性 html shee ble 版本兼容 mpat src less <!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<
array_column 低版本兼容
true style isnull inpu slice strong is_null exists cnblogs function i_array_column($input, $columnKey, $indexKey=null){ if(!function
jquery 不同版本兼容
x11 function html pla code jquer scrip string .html <script src = "js/jquery.min.js"></script> <script> //這裏,添加你的插件
APP接口版本兼容問題
ID 必須 xxxx oid 兼容問題 接口開發 color 使用 OS 標記一下,不知道我們目前的處理方式,後續問問: 轉載:大河 http://www.cnblogs.com/dahe007/p/6255401.html APP接口版本兼容的問題 現在基本每個公
8-高級路由:RIP版本兼容實驗
edi 原則 proc out pro rip 技術分享 結果 RoCE 一、實驗拓撲:Note:1、V1版本:只發送V1更新,接收V1/2更新;V2版本:只發送及接收V2更新。 2、把R1變為版本2,發現R2有R1的路由條目,但是R1沒有R2的路由條目。因為版本2是組播,
Net dll組件版本兼容問題
更多 red 程序集 lse 時間 開始 版本沖突 run details dll組件版本兼容問題,是生產開發中經常遇到的問題,常見組件兼容問題如:Newtonsoft.Json,log4net等 為了節約大家時間,想直接看解決方法的,可直接點擊目錄3、4 目錄 1.版本
使用axios對安卓或者ios低版本兼容性處理
-c 使用 cnp ios from 兼容 無法使用 sel size 原因:不支持ES6,無法使用promise 解決辦法: 1.安裝 es6-promise cnpm install es6-promise --save-dev 2.引入 es6-promise
axios 安卓低版本兼容性處理
版本 ins from fill -- clas and 問題 axios 問題: 在較低版本的android手機中發現封裝的 http 無效,我測試使用的是android 4.4的老手機,主要就是無法使用promise。 解決方案 安裝 npm install es6-
babel版本兼容報錯處理:Plugin/Preset files are not allowed to export objects
cor cin 就會 babel containe 錯誤 lpad 什麽 dex 原文地址: https://www.cnblogs.com/jiebba/p/9618930.html 1、為什麽會報錯 ? 這裏抱著錯誤是因為 babel 的版本沖突。 多是因為
自定義外掛-讓IE9以下的瀏覽器支援H5屬性placeholder
自從有了H5讓我們喜也讓我們憂,新特性用起來很炫、很酷提高了不少工作效率,但不得不考慮該死的IE瀏覽器(從此微軟的形象一落千丈)。 在H5中我們會使用placeholder屬性來實現文字水印提示資訊。 <input placeholder="智學無憂IT教育"&g
讓IE9以下版本支援HTML5
1、從IE9開始到後繼的版本都支援HTML5,那麼怎麼讓IE9以下的版本支援HTML5呢? 這裡有一個JS檔案,原始檔如下: (function(k,m){var g="3.7.0";var d=k.html5||{};var h=/^<|^(?:button|map
bootstrap模板為使IE6、7、8版本(IE9以下版本)瀏覽器相容html5和css3
<script src="https://oss.maxcdn.com/libs/html5shiv/3.7.0/html5shiv.js"></script> <script src="https://oss.maxcdn.com
Spring boot和Spring cloud對應版本兼容問題
通過 org als 3.x 使用 The 2.0 uil 引入 Spring boot和Spring cloud對應版本兼容問題 最近要搭建一個網關系統,使用到了Spring cloud,在引入對應的依賴後,啟動時報錯org.springframework.boot.b
h5新標簽IE8不兼容怎麽辦?
doctype lan right otto cnblogs spa pre document con <!doctype html> <html lang="en"> <head> <meta charset="UTF-
解決html5新標簽 placeholder 低版本瀏覽器下不兼容問題
解決 html5 新標簽 placeholder屬性是HTML5 中為input添加的。在input上提供一個占位符,文字形式展示輸入字段預期值的提示信息(hint),該字段會在輸入為空時顯示。實例:1 <input type="text" name="userName" placehold
如何處理HTML5新標簽的兼容性問題
新增 框架 結構 type ie7 ie 9 最好 好的 scrip 支持HTML5新標簽: * IE8/IE7/IE6支持通過document.createElement方法產生的標簽, 可以利用這一特性讓這些瀏覽器支持HTML5新標簽, 瀏覽器支持新標簽後,